Forrester Research To Address How China and India Will Redefine the Technology World Order
Indo-Chinese Influence In Global Tech Sector Not Preordained
WHAT: The technology industry's historical US-centric world
        order is waning due to the rapid growth of India and China,
        with their tech-savvy middle-class, IT-hungry corporations,
        and rapidly expanding innovation capabilities. Forrester
        Research, Inc. (Nasdaq: FORR) projects three scenarios for the
        evolution of this new tech world order based on how a number
        of factors play out, including India's and China's sustained
        domestic market growth rates and governmental support for free
        market activities.

        Regardless of how the global tech sector evolves during the
        next two decades, US tech vendors should learn to cooperate
        through global Innovation Networks: multipolar ecosystems that
        exploit India's and China's huge markets and growing talent
        pools. Forrester's advice: Assess your willingness to take
        risks when investing in these emerging markets.
